Boston Mayor Michelle Wu issued something none of her predecessors had been able to muster: an eloquent, full-throated apology to Willie Bennett and Alan Swanson.
Wu formally apologized on behalf of the city to two Black men who were wrongly linked to the fatal shooting 34 years ago of a white pregnant mother after her husband, Charles Stuart, lied to cover up his crime.
"Murder in Boston: Roots, Rage and Reckoning," HBO's new three-part docuseries, detailed Charles "Chuck" Stuart's murder of his pregnant wife and his attempts to mislead police.
